Installation Treatments.

The new taps are less complicated to set up than older models. Most makers include all links and also installations needed to install the device yourself. Full installation guidelines are included with the faucet. Search for full sets that feature the adaptable hose pipes required to attach to your water system. If these aren't consisted of, you will need to acquire them individually. Do not be startled if you notice particles in the water when you complete installment. This is just bits trapped in the component from manufacturing as well as installment. They will rinse clear if you allow the water compete a couple of minutes.

Kitchen Area Taps: Repair Work as well as Upkeep.

Repairing and maintenance is much easier than in the past and can be done by a helpful home owner. Rubber rings can be conveniently replaced in your home when needed. Before working with the sink, turn off the water and cover the drains. Effectively cleaning and preserving your faucet will certainly extend the life and keep it in good working order.

Inspect the maker's instructions for cleansing the coating. Most can be cleaned with moderate soap and also water or home window cleaner. Do not use severe cleaning products, which can damage the surface. Polish matte completed with a furnishings brightens. Examine the tag to be sure the item you utilize is risk-free for the product of your fixtures.

How to Install or Replace Your Kitchen Faucet: A Step-by-Step Guide

 

Tools and Materials Needed

 

Of course, the most important thing you need before starting any kitchen faucet installation is the new faucet. You can pick out a kitchen faucet online or in any home improvement store. The entire process will be easier if you choose one with the same number and same-size holes as your old model, but it's not technically necessary.


Next, take a look at your new faucet and your existing sink to see if you have the proper materials for hooking everything up. Some faucets have already-attached tubing on the faucet end already while others will just hook up to standard tubing lines. If you can choose your tubing, most experts recommend braided steel supply lines, which are sturdy and flexible, and have leak-proof connectors already attached. Most sinks just need tubes measuring 12 inches in length and three-eighths of an inch to a half-inch in diameter. Check your faucet and sink to make sure standard sizes will work.

Pay Attention

 

The most important tip for installing a kitchen faucet is simply to pay attention as you work. This type of installation doesn’t require any special skills or technical knowledge. However, there are a lot of small parts that must be assembled in the correct order to prevent leaks or other mishaps. Before you start, read over all the installation instructions that came with your faucet. If you're new to working with faucets, watch some online instructional videos from a source you trust.

 

Prepare for Tight Squeezes

 

Once you get started, you’ll quickly find that the tricky part is just being able to reach into tight places and turn various nuts and bolts. If possible, invest in a basin wrench to make this job easier.

 

Cut It Out

 

Another tip for saving on time is cutting out your old faucet. If you aren't planning on using your leaky faucet again, you can just cut through assembly parts to pop it right off your sink.

 

Get the Picture?

 

If you’re worried about being able to reattach everything properly, consider taking a photo before you start. This can help you remember the original plumbing configuration.

 

Mind the Gaps

 

To prevent leaks, use caulk under the faucet plate and Teflon tape around the supply-line connectors.
